D-Methionine Usage And Synthesis

Chemical PropertiesWhite crystalline powder
UsesD-Methionine is used to rescue noise-induced hearing loss. It is used to improve the nutritive value of animal feed.
DefinitionChEBI: An optically active form of methionine having D-configuration.
Biochem/physiol ActionsD-methionine has been shown to rescue noise-induced hearing loss.

The general procedure for the determination of N-d-AAase activity using N-acetyl-D-methionine as substrate was as follows: first, N-d-AAase was incubated with N-acetyl-D-methionine at 4°C. Subsequently, a colorimetric solution mixture containing d-amino acid oxidase (coupled with horseradish peroxidase), peroxidase (10 U/mL), 4-aminoantipyrine (0.04 mg/mL) and phenol (0.8 mM) was added. Absorbance (OD) was measured at 520 nm. The unit of enzyme activity was defined as the amount of catalytic production of 1 μmol D-methionine per minute. Protein concentration was determined by the Bradford method using bovine serum albumin as standard [32]. The kinetic parameters kcat and Km were determined by fitting the initial rate as a function of substrate concentration to the Michaelis-Menten equation.
